Steve <twopi(_at_)altavista(_dot_)com>:
Hello,
I've downloaded and successfully built fetchmail 5.9.0 but fetchmailconf
(1.39) fails with the following complaint:
Fields don't match what fetchmailconf expected:
Not matched in class `Configuration' signature: ['spambounce']
I don't know python, but I found no obvious syntax errors where "spambounce"
is referenced. When I comment out all the code/blocks that reference
spambounce, I just get other errors:
Fields don't match what fetchmailconf expected:
Not matched in class `Server' signature: ['auth', 'principal',
'tracepolls']
Not matched in dictionary keys: ['preauth']
Fetchmail itself works great, and fetchmailconf 1.28 works fine, but I cannot
figure out why this version of fetchmailconf will not work. I don't even know
what to try next because that error doesn't make any sense to me. Seems
dain-bramaged for fetchmailconf to claim it doesn't understand the very
fields that it, itself, has defined...
Odd. I can't reproduce this. Would you please send me a copy of your
.fetchmailrc? It's OK to mask the passwords.
--
<a href="http://www.tuxedo.org/~esr/">Eric S. Raymond</a>
False is the idea of utility that sacrifices a thousand real advantages for
one imaginary or trifling inconvenience; that would take fire from men because
it burns, and water because one may drown in it; that has no remedy for evils
except destruction. The laws that forbid the carrying of arms are laws of
such a nature. They disarm only those who are neither inclined nor determined
to commit crimes.
-- Cesare Beccaria, as quoted by Thomas Jefferson's Commonplace book